Has anyone heard of or used EA's new sunblock? It is available only from physicians' offices, which I think is just stupid as a distribution mechanism.
New York, NY, March 4, 2014 – Elizabeth Arden, Inc. today, in tandem with the release of a clinical study published in the Journal of Drugs in Dermatology, unveiled Triple Protection Factor Broad Spectrum Sunscreen SPF 50+, or TPF 50, a groundbreaking new anti-aging product. TPF 50 was developed based on a unique combination of protective ingredients including a DNA Enzyme Complex, a highly potent protein protection Antioxidant Complex and broad spectrum SPF 50+ sun protection. This combination works synergistically to create the most effective topical skin protection on the market. TPF 50 is the first of a comprehensive new skincare line, Elizabeth Arden Rx, designed for exclusive distribution in physician offices.

I don't like that the titanium is listed before the zinc (or that it has titanium at all, actually -- less expensive filler). No percentage of either. I'd like to know WHY it's the "most effective" topical skin protection, and that's impossible to know without more info.
Active Ingredients:Titanium Dioxide, Zinc Oxide Inactive Ingredients: Water/Aqua/Eau, Cyclopentasiloxane, isododecane, C12-15 Alkyl Benzoate, Caprylyl Methicone, Dimethicone, Polyglyceryl-3 Polydimethylsiloxyethyl Glycol, Aluminum Hydroxide, Stearic Acid, Disteatdimonium Hectorite, Ricinoleth-40, Ethoxydiglycol, Carnosine, acetyl Farnesylcysteine, Acrylates/Ethylhexyl Acrylate/Dimethicone Methacrylate Copolymer, Allyl Caproate, Arabidopsis Thaliana Extract, Butylene Glycol, Caprylyl Glycol, Chondrus Crispus Extract, Dipropylene Glycol, Ergothioneine, Ethyl Decadienoate, Hdi/Trimethylol Hexyllactone Crosspolymer, Hydrogen Dimethicone, Lecithin, Methyldihdrojasmonate, Methylenedioxyphenyl Methylpropanal, Micrococcus Lysate, Peg/Ppg-18/18 Dimethicone, Plankton Extract, Sodium Hyaluronate, Sodium Pca, Tocopheryl Acetate, Triethoxycaprylylsilane, Silica, Chlorphenesin, Phenoxyethanol, Potassium Sorbate, Sodium Dehydroacetate, Iron Oxides (CI 77491, CI 77492, CI 77499).
